Understanding AWS Route 53

DNS Management Simplified

AWS Route 53, named after the traditional port 53 used for DNS, simplifies the process of managing domain names and routing internet traffic. Whether you're hosting a simple website or running complex applications, Route 53 ensures that end-users can access your services with minimal latency and maximum reliability.

 Key Features

 1. Domain Registration

Route 53 allows users to register new domain names, providing a seamless process to claim a unique web address. The service supports various top-level domains (TLDs), allowing businesses and individuals to choose a domain that aligns with their brand or purpose.

 2. DNS Routing Policies

One of Route 53's powerful features is its ability to control the routing of traffic based on different policies. Whether you need simple round-robin load balancing, latency-based routing, or weighted routing for A/B testing, Route 53 provides the flexibility to tailor your DNS responses to specific needs.

 3. Health Checks

Route 53 includes health-check capabilities, allowing you to monitor the health of your resources. With configurable health checks, you can automate the process of routing traffic away from unhealthy endpoints, ensuring high availability and minimizing downtime.

 4. Content Delivery Network (CDN) Integration

Route 53 seamlessly integrates with AWS's CloudFront CDN service. This integration enables you to distribute content globally, improving the performance of your web applications by reducing latency and accelerating the delivery of static and dynamic content.

 AWS Route 53 in Action

 Use Cases

 1. Web Hosting

For businesses hosting websites, Route 53 simplifies domain management and ensures that users worldwide can access the site with minimal latency. The ability to integrate with other AWS services, such as S3 for static website hosting or EC2 for dynamic content, makes Route 53 a go-to solution for web hosting.

 2. Load Balancing and Failover

In scenarios where high availability is paramount, Route 53 shines. By leveraging its routing policies, you can distribute traffic across multiple endpoints, such as EC2 instances or load balancers. Health checks enable automatic failover, redirecting traffic away from unhealthy resources to maintain a seamless user experience.

 3. Global Content Delivery

For applications with a global user base, integrating Route 53 with CloudFront creates a powerful combination. This ensures that content is delivered from the edge location closest to the user, optimizing performance and reducing latency.

 4. Hybrid Cloud Architecture

Organizations with a hybrid cloud architecture, combining on-premises infrastructure with cloud services, can use Route 53 to seamlessly integrate their DNS management. This allows for a unified and consistent approach to domain management across the hybrid environment.
